Network Structure of High-tech Industry National Value Chain and Decomposition of Provincial Added Value:the Evidence from Electronic Information Industry |
Wan Ke,Chen Pu,Zhang Ying,Chen Lu |
(School of Economics and Management, East China Jiaotong University, Nanchang 330013, China) |
|
|
Abstract In order to solve the dilemma of low-end lock in the global value chain of high-tech industry, China needs to build and improve the division system of national value chain. This paper constructs the analysis framework of endogenous value-added transmission structure of China's high-tech industry national value chain (NVC), and decomposes the provincial domestic added value by taking electronic information industry as an example. The results show that at present, the upstream technology R&D ability of China's electronic information industry is weak, as well as the overall value-added ability; Both the number and correlation coefficient of the downstream indirectly related industrial sectors are still to be improved; Except of midstream, the domestic added value from exports and the international competitiveness in the upstream and downstream are both low; The eastern and central provinces have their own advantages in terms of domestic total added value and endogenous value-added capacity, while the domestic total added value and endogenous value-added capacity of northeast and western provinces are both weak. At the same time, the degree of international vertical specialization of China's provinces, which is different between provinces in the same region, does not show obvious geographical characteristics.
